Фронтенд-дайджест №622 (20 - 26 травня 2024)
Веброзробка
-
Як Spotify використовував Picture-in-Picture API для створення мініплеєра Spotify
-
Краще розуміння помилок та попереджень в консолі за допомогою Gemini
-
Продуктивність
CSS
- Сучасні CSS макети: Для цього вам може не знадобитися фреймворк
- Представляємо Pigment CSS: нове покоління CSS-in-JS
- Про відповідність та читабельність: Створення кольорів тексту за допомогою CSS
- У нас тепер є Container Queries, але чи використовуємо ми їх насправді?
- contrast-color() - хороша штука, але вирішує проблему не на тому рівні
- Чи варто використовувати властивість CSS text-emphasis для заголовків?
- Посібник з впровадження Bulma CSS: Огляд, приклади та альтернативи
- Покращуйте CSS view transitions за допомогою Velvette
JavaScript
-
Альтернатива для Websocket: як використовувати Firestore для прослуховування подій у реальному часі
-
React
-
Vue
-
Angular
- Angular v18 вже доступний!
- Методи налагодження - Angular DevTools
- Методи налагодження - Chrome DevTools
- Прощаємося з Zone.js: Що нового в Angular 18?
- Оновлення до Angular Material 18: збереження підтримки для Material 2 та додавання підтримки для Material 3
- Angular Tutorial: Використання @HostBinding з Signals